Title: Senior Operations Coordinator

Location: Madison, Wisconsin 53718 USA

Duration: 12 Months

WHAT IS THIS JOB?

The Senior Operations Coordinator delivers administrative support to individuals at levels in the business, multiple offices, and teams. This position involves coordinating and executing complex administrative activities and projects while demonstrating a high level of discretion when handling confidential items. The Senior Administrative Assistant actively contributes to project planning and basic project management, serves as a mentor for team members – including onboarding support, and acts as a subject matter expert in improving administrative functions.

Must Have Skill:

  • Stakeholder Management - The process of organizing, communicating, monitoring, and improving relationships with stakeholders.
  • Business Process Improvements - The process of analyzing business processes and workflows within the organization and identifying new approaches to redesign business activities or optimize performance, quality, and speed of processes – including identifying and evaluating process automation opportunities.
  • Communication Management - The systematic planning, implementation, monitoring, and revision of communications through the use of various communication tools and channels.
  • Customer Experience Management - The practice of designing and reacting to customer interactions to meet or exceed customer expectations, thereby increasing customer satisfaction, loyalty and advocacy.
  • Data Analysis - The process of measuring and managing organizational data, identifying methodological best practices and conducting statistical analyses.
  • Data Preparation - The process of gathering, combining, structuring and organizing data so it can be used in various business applications such as business intelligence (BI), analytics and data visualization.
  • Knowledge Management - The process of identifying, creating, organizing, sharing, using, storing, and disseminating knowledge and information within the organization.
  • Prioritization - The process of determining the order in which tasks or projects should be completed by evaluating the benefits and impact that completion would bring.
  • Records Management - The creation, distribution, usage, maintenance, and disposition of recorded information cultivated as evidence of business activities and transactions.
  • Scheduling Management - The process of planning and maintaining a schedule including appointments, travel, and other logistical planning activities.

Primary Accountabilities

  • Collaborate across teams to facilitate seamless project coordination. Develop comprehensive project plans, including timelines and milestones, to guide effective execution. Establish and manage checkpoints for timely progress on action items. Contribute to basic project planning and execution by coordinating schedules, resources, and logistics.
  • Provides subject matter expertise regarding administrative functions and recommendations for solutions and improvements to increase efficiency of existing procedures, along with documenting and/or developing of new procedures as needed.
  • Coordinate and support contractors and vendors. Fostering positive and effective relationships, ensuring open lines of communication for success.
  • Act as a mentor and go-to resource for employees, providing guidance, support, and assistance in navigating various aspects of their roles and projects. Foster a collaborative learning environment by encouraging knowledge exchange among team members, promoting a culture of mentorship and growth.
  • Prepares and ensures accuracy of requested information, reports, recommendations, and project outcomes/findings. Share knowledge insights with team members to foster continuous learning and professional development.
  • Performs duties of Administrative Assistant II and travels to support business functions as needed.
  • Engages in other duties as needed that support Alliant Energy’s Values and helps deliver on our Purpose to serve customers and build stronger communities.
